Academic Comparison between VanderCook College of Music and Ambria College of Nursing

VanderCook College of Music and Ambria College of Nursing are frequently compared when students or parents prepare college admissions. VanderCook College of Music is a four-year, private (not-for-profit) school located in Chicago, IL and Ambria College of Nursing is a four-year, private (for-profit) school located in Hoffman Estates, IL.
